The Student Supports Manager (SSM) role within the School-Based SEL & Behavioral Health Team is designed to execute the integrated student services initiative of Communities In Schools of Chicago. Each SSM is strategically placed in a partner school within the Chicago Public Schools system. The SSM will focus on delivering comprehensive student services that encompass school-wide prevention, educational initiatives, and enrichment strategies, alongside providing targeted support and interventions for individual students.


KEY RESPONSIBILITIES:
  • Deliver personalized case management to a caseload of 50 students across elementary, middle, or high school levels, assisting them in overcoming challenges related to academics, behavior, and attendance, while contributing to broader school climate improvement efforts.
  • Collaborate effectively with school staff and community stakeholders to address student challenges and opportunities, including active participation on the school’s Behavioral Health Team or similar committees.
  • Maintain accurate and timely student case files, including detailed case notes and necessary documentation.
  • Leverage the extensive range of support services and community resources offered by the CIS of Chicago Partnerships Team.
  • Engage in regular meetings with team members, organizational staff, and clinical teams to ensure alignment and effective service delivery.
  • Support additional organizational projects and activities as required.

DESIRED SKILLS AND ATTRIBUTES:
  • Proven experience in providing both individual and group interventions for school-aged youth.
  • Demonstrated cultural competency in working with diverse populations, respecting varying value systems, ethnicities, cultural backgrounds, language skills, and abilities.
  • Confidence in representing Communities In Schools of Chicago through various engagements, including site visits, public speaking, community events, and occasional media interactions.
  • Proficient in computer applications, including Microsoft Word, Excel, and PowerPoint, as well as experience with database management.

QUALIFICATIONS:
  • A Master’s degree in Social Work or Counseling is preferred (licensure or eligibility for licensure is advantageous).
  • A minimum of three years of experience working with adolescents, their families, and urban public school environments is highly desirable.
  • Possession of a valid driver’s license and reliable access to transportation is required.
  • A background check and verification of previous employment and educational credentials are mandatory; candidates must not be listed on the CPS 'Do Not Hire' registry.
